FT-IR and FT-FIR studies of vanadium, molybdenum and tungsten oxides supported on different carriers

Abstract

In the far IR region at low molybdenum loadings, Mo-SiO2 catalysts present a pseudomolybdate or a polymolybdate species, while bulk-like MoO3 appears at loadings close to the geometrical monolayer coverage. W-SiO2 and V-SiO2 spectra show bands close to those observed on the corresponding bulk oxides.

In the case of TiO2, Al2O3, ZrO2 supported catalysts, a band is observed near 1000 cm−1 which is assigned to the Mo=O stretching vibration of coordinatively unsaturated Mon+ ions showing a stronger interaction with the support than one observed on silica.
